> The 'tver' resource type is reserved for use as specified by
> PalmSource.  Right now, IDs 1 and 1000 have specific meanings.  In the
> future, other ID values could also have specific meanings, so using them
> for your own purposes is dangerous.
>
> Any resource ID that is all lower-case is reserved for system use.  Unless
> you have a good reason to use it, avoid them.  Why not just do 'Date' as a
> resource and use that?  That's in the user-defined range and is even more
> self-documenting.
